Output 41aaf59f19018699419f2bfd61c65dfcdcfb1249bf8f40a6c0edfb0455186933:0

value
208159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18353eaefa25546d43a2b222e9cb15eaf3f56d0f OP_EQUAL
address
33u1vfY77gzMMAnP8bJMzmrNDYpZtytoBW
transaction
41aaf59f19018699419f2bfd61c65dfcdcfb1249bf8f40a6c0edfb0455186933
confirmations
402443
spent
true